Single-layer polyethylene film has poor barrier properties to oxygen and other gases. When packaging fried foods and other foods, it is easy to cause contamination at the seal. General liquid packaging polyethylene film has poor sealing performance for this type of packaging and cannot meet the packaging process and requirements. The requirements for the storage period of packaging items, so it is necessary to use multi-layer polyethylene modified film or composite film with good barrier performance and inclusion sealing performance

[0014] A kind of packaging plastic substrate film containing itaconate, it is made by the raw material of following parts by weight (kg): homogeneous ethylene / alpha olefin copolymer 23.7, LDPE low-density polyethylene 50, SG-1 Type polyvinyl chloride 15, epoxy linseed oil 5, polyethylene wax powder 3, isopropyl distearoyloxyaluminate 2.5, diatomaceous earth 10, polyisobutylene 0.8, poly-4-methyl-1 -pentene 1.1, modified limestone powder 3, 4,4-methylene (2,6-di-tert-butylphenol) 2.7, triethyl citrate 1.1, itaconate 0.8, calcium stearate 1.3, Anilinomethyltriethoxysilane 2.6, ferrocene 0.6, modified montmorillonite powder 1.9;

Abstract

The invention discloses a package-purposed plastic-based film containing itaconate. The package-purposed plastic-based film is prepared from the following raw materials in parts by weight: 20-25 parts of homogenous ethylene / alpha olefin copolymer, 45-50 parts of LDPE (Low-Density Polyethylene), 10-15 parts of SG-1 type polyvinyl chloride, 3-5 parts of epoxidized linseed oil, 2-3 parts of polyethlene wax powder, 1.5-2.5 parts of distearoyl isopropoxy aluminate, 8-12 parts of kieselguhr, 0.5-1 part of polyisobutene, 0.8-1.5 parts of poly-4-methyl-1-amylene, 1.5-3 parts of modified limestone powder, 2-3 parts of 4,4-methlene(2,6-di-tert-butylphenol), 0.7-1.4 parts of triethyl citrate, 0.5-1 part of itaconate, 0.8-1.6 parts of calcium stearate, 1.2-2.6 parts of anilino-methyl-triethoxysilane, 0.3-0.7 part of dicyclopentadienyl iron and 1.5-2.4 parts of modified smectite powder. The package-purposed plastic-based film has good barrier property, gas tightness, pressure resistance and impact resistance and has the characteristics of high heat seal strength and good heat seal property.
